Incredible Growth Trajectory
On January 7, 2026, Blackbird.AI, recognized as a leader in safeguarding organizations against narrative attacks, announced significant advancements in their growth metrics. The company reported an astonishing 118% year-over-year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) growth, highlighting their increasing relevance in a rapidly changing digital landscape.

Investors have shown tremendous confidence in the company's vision, with $28 million secured in recent strategic funding. This brings their total funding to $58 million, signaling healthy investor relations and solid market promise. Among the participants in this funding round were notable names such as Ten Eleven Ventures and Dorilton Ventures, along with influential figures in the cybersecurity realm like Dave DeWalt and Chris Young, both renowned for their contributions to leading technology companies.

The Rise of Narrative Attacks
As organizations increasingly face threats from manipulated narratives, Blackbird.AI aims to protect brands and top executives from disinformation and misinformation campaigns that have become a pressing concern. The company's technology platform focuses on detecting and mitigating the impacts of narrative attacks, which, as the World Economic Forum has identified, pose the number one global threat for two consecutive years.

Looking ahead, Gartner predicts that enterprise spending aimed at battling misinformation could exceed $30 billion by 2028, reflecting a critical need for innovative solutions to address these emerging threats. Blackbird.AI's performance and strategic direction seem to position them well in an industry that is set to boom.

Innovative Solutions at Work
Blackbird.AI’s platform views narratives as both opportunities and threats. Their cutting-edge AI technology analyzes potential misrepresentations that could affect businesses, ensuring a timely response to threats. The spectrum of narrative attacks is broad, affecting everything from corporate reputations to national security initiatives.

CEO Wasim Khaled elaborated on the urgency of this offering: “The cost of narrative attacks has collapsed, and the consequences have exploded. Threat actors are operationalizing narrative warfare against several fronts.” Recognizing this challenge, Blackbird.AI continues to enhance its technology while fostering key partnerships to better serve its clientele.

The company has also introduced new features such as Compass Context and Compass Vision, both designed to lend clarity in the cloud of misinformation endemic to today's information landscape.
